How complex is origami design?

Résumé

The latest decade saw the emergence of a new approach to the ancient paperfolding art: the computational origami.Several complex planar geometry problems have been studied from their complexity and design efficiency point of view, such as the color changing. The checkered patterns are amonst the most challenging problems, especially when constrained by searching the most efficient design, i.e. with the less waste of paper.We propose herein the illustration of complexity on a pixel-matrix origami design, a complication of the chessboard: each board square should be able to change its color independently, using as many flapping mechanisms as necessary, but still using a single square sheet of paper with a minimal waste.
